#c567f7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c567f7 is composed of 77.3% red, 40.4%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 279.2 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 68.6%. #c567f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#8b00ef.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

● #c567f7 color description : Soft violet.
The hexadecimal color #c567f7 has RGB values of R:197, G:103, B:247 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 12937207.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0110 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0abb3 is the less saturated color, while #c761fd is the most saturated one.
